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"an impromptu chat"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to describe a spontaneous or unplanned conversation that occurs without prior arrangement. Example: "During the conference, I had an impromptu chat with a fellow attendee about our shared interests in technology."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"an impromptu chat" to describe conversations that arise spontaneously, without prior planning. It's suitable for both personal and professional contexts where the tone is relatively informal.
Common error
Avoid using "impromptu" excessively in your writing. While it accurately describes unplanned events, overuse can make your text sound stilted. Vary your vocabulary with synonyms like "spontaneous" or "unplanned" to maintain a natural flow.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
a spontaneous conversation
Emphasizes the unplanned nature of the conversation. Replaces 'impromptu' with 'spontaneous'.
an unplanned discussion
Replaces 'chat' with 'discussion', suggesting a slightly more formal interaction.
a casual talk
Highlights the relaxed atmosphere of the conversation.
an off-the-cuff conversation
Uses a more idiomatic expression to convey the lack of preparation.
a spur-of-the-moment discussion
Highlights the sudden decision to have the conversation.
an informal exchange
Focuses on the relaxed and unstructured nature of the communication.
a chance encounter leading to conversation
Emphasizes the element of unexpected meeting and subsequent talk.
an ad-hoc dialogue
Uses 'ad-hoc', a more formal term, to describe the unplanned nature.
a quick word
Implies a brief and casual conversation.
a passing remark leading to dialogue
Highlights the brevity and casualness of the initial interaction.
FAQs
How can I use "an impromptu chat" in a sentence?
"An impromptu chat" describes a spontaneous, unplanned conversation. For example, "We had "an impromptu chat" about the weather while waiting for the bus."
What's a good alternative to "an impromptu chat"?
Alternatives include "a spontaneous conversation", "an unplanned discussion", or "a casual talk", depending on the formality and context.
What does "impromptu" mean in the context of "an impromptu chat"?
In this context, "impromptu" means unplanned or spontaneous. It indicates that the conversation happened without any prior arrangement or intention.
Is it appropriate to use "an impromptu chat" in a formal setting?
While "an impromptu chat" isn't strictly inappropriate, consider using more formal alternatives like "an unplanned discussion" or "a spontaneous conversation" in highly formal settings.
